Attention Sports Fans: Have you been searching for a great place to watch the game? A place where you can watch your favorite team play while still enjoying delicious food? Well look no further, Lagasse’s Stadium, located in The Palazzo, is just what you have been looking for. This 24,000 square-foot restaurant is outfitted with nearly 100 high-definition screens, access to nearly every major sports event you can think of, lounge and stadium seating, and cuisine from world-famous chef Emeril Lagasse. Stadium guests are treated to the full “Game Day” experience while enjoying fun, inventive and intelligent dishes.
